SUMMARY/OBJECTIVES

Mitigates fraud though Treasury Management risk assessments and control measure reviews. Collaborates with various departments (Credit Administration, Compliance, IT, Legal, Audit and Operations) across the Bank to report risk findings and vulnerabilities with Treasury Management customer base Performs internal reviews to confirm that Treasury Management documentation, internal processes and procedures are compliant with regulatory guidelines.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

  • Develop and maintain knowledge of products, services and pricing, service setup documentation, operating systems, and data transmissions, file formats and protocols used for the delivery and support of Treasury Management products and services.
  • Monitors activity and trends in client transactional behavior to help mitigate fraud.
  • Performs risk and control process reviews.
  • Creates, maintains and provides analysis of in-depth weekly / monthly / quarterly management reporting.
  • Coordinates risk mitigation efforts with Credit Administration, Compliance, IT, Legal, Audit and Operations.
  • Work across the organization to deploy and manage a risk-based approach and streamline process, while ensuring compliance and alignment with bank-wide policies and procedures, external standards and regulatory requirements.
  • Work closely with Risk, Compliance and Product Managers to maintain oversight over emerging and existing key risks, controls and corrective actions.
  • Ensure that client Treasury Management documentation, internal processes and procedures are compliant with regulatory guidelines.
  • Maintain appropriate tracking logs, based on client additions/changes/deletions.
  • Provide subject matter expertise to internal bank staff as required.
  • Assist with special projects as required.
